What is a Gas Powered Fence Post Driver? A Deep Dive
A gas powered fence post driver, also known as a gasoline-powered post driver or a motorized post pounder, is a portable power tool designed to drive fence posts into the ground quickly and efficiently. Unlike manual post drivers or hydraulic systems, these tools utilize a small gasoline engine to generate the impact force needed to sink posts, significantly reducing the physical labor involved in fence installation. The evolution of the gas powered fence post driver has been driven by the need for increased efficiency and reduced strain on workers, especially in large-scale fencing projects.
Core Components and Functionality
At its heart, a gas powered fence post driver consists of a small two- or four-stroke gasoline engine, a striking mechanism, and a post-receiving sleeve. The engine powers a piston that repeatedly strikes the top of the post, driving it into the ground. A spring or pneumatic system assists in delivering a powerful and consistent impact. The post-receiving sleeve ensures proper alignment and prevents damage to the post during the driving process.
Beyond the Basics: Understanding the Nuances
While the basic principle is straightforward, the effectiveness of a gas powered fence post driver depends on several factors, including engine power, impact frequency, and the design of the striking mechanism. More advanced models may incorporate features like vibration dampening, adjustable impact force, and compatibility with different post sizes. Understanding these nuances is crucial for selecting the right tool for a specific application.

Cons/Limitations: Potential Drawbacks
1. **Weight:** The GPD 40 is relatively heavy, which can be a factor for some users.
2. **Noise Level:** Like all gas-powered tools, the GPD 40 can be noisy, requiring the use of hearing protection.
3. **Maintenance:** Regular maintenance is required to keep the engine running smoothly.
4. **Cost:** The GPD 40 is a significant investment compared to manual post drivers.

1. **What type of fuel does the Rhino GPD 40 use?**
The Rhino GPD 40 uses regular unleaded gasoline. It’s essential to use fresh fuel and follow the manufacturer’s recommendations for fuel-to-oil ratio (if applicable).
2. **How often should I service the engine on the Rhino GPD 40?**
Engine servicing frequency depends on usage, but generally, you should change the oil every 25 hours of operation or at least once a year. Regularly check the air filter and spark plug.
3. **Can the Rhino GPD 40 drive posts into rocky soil?**
Yes, the Rhino GPD 40 is capable of driving posts into rocky soil, but it may require more effort and careful positioning. Avoid driving directly into large rocks, as this can damage the post or the driver.
4. **What size posts can the Rhino GPD 40 drive?**
The Rhino GPD 40 can drive posts ranging from 1″ to 4″ in diameter, depending on the adapter sleeve being used. Check the manufacturer’s specifications for the exact range.

7. **How do I prevent the post from splitting when driving it with the Rhino GPD 40?**
To prevent splitting, ensure the post is properly aligned and use a driving cap or adapter sleeve that fits snugly. Avoid overdriving the post.
